/++ Author: Aziz Köksal License: GPL3 +/ module cmd.Compile; import dil.semantic.Module; import dil.semantic.Pass1; import dil.semantic.Pass2; import dil.semantic.Symbols; import dil.doc.Doc; import dil.Compilation; import dil.Information; import dil.ModuleManager; import common; /// The compile command. struct CompileCommand { string[] filePaths; /// Explicitly specified modules (on the command line.) ModuleManager moduleMan; SemanticPass1[] passes1; CompilationContext context; InfoManager infoMan; /// Executes the compile command. void run() { moduleMan = new ModuleManager(context.importPaths, infoMan); foreach (filePath; filePaths) { auto modul = moduleMan.loadModuleFile(filePath); runPass1(modul); printSymbolTable(modul, ""); } // foreach (modul; moduleMan.loadedModules) // { // auto pass2 = new SemanticPass2(modul); // pass2.run(); // } } /// Runs the first pass on modul. void runPass1(Module modul) { if (modul.hasErrors || modul.semanticPass != 0) return; auto pass1 = new SemanticPass1(modul, context); pass1.importModule = &importModule; pass1.run(); passes1 ~= pass1; } /// Imports a module and runs the first pass on it. Module importModule(string moduleFQNPath) { auto modul = moduleMan.loadModule(moduleFQNPath); modul && runPass1(modul); return modul; } /// Prints all symbols recursively (for debugging.) static void printSymbolTable(ScopeSymbol scopeSym, char[] indent) { foreach (member; scopeSym.members) { auto tokens = getDocTokens(member.node); char[] docText; foreach (token; tokens) docText ~= token.srcText; Stdout(indent).formatln("Id:{}, Symbol:{}, DocText:{}", member.name.str, member.classinfo.name, docText); if (auto s = cast(ScopeSymbol)member) printSymbolTable(s, indent ~ "→ "); } } }
